ICD-9-CM
International Classification of Diseases, Ninth Revision, Clinical Modification, a system used in the United States until 2015 to code and classify morbidity data from inpatient and outpatient records, including physician offices.
ICD-10-CM
The International Classification of Diseases, Tenth Revision, Clinical Modification; a system used for coding and classifying diagnoses and procedures associated with hospital utilization in the United States.
Surgery
A branch of medicine that involves the treatment of injuries or disorders by cutting open the body and repairing or removing damaged organs and tissues.
